The School of Philosophy, Psychology and Language Sciences (PPLS) is pleased to offer a number of PhD scholarships for programmers starting in the academic year.

The Scholarships are available to postgraduate students intending to study for a PhD within PPLS on either a full or part-time basis.

The awards are offered on a highly competitive basis and are subject to annual renewal.

These scholarships are funded by the School of PPLS. Psychology at Edinburgh brings together world-class researchers approaching the scientific study of mind and behaviour through a range of topics – from language development to dementia, personality to paranormal beliefs.

Scholarship Description

Application Deadline: November
Course Level: Scholarships are available to study PhD scholarship
Study Subject: Scholarships are available for Philosophy, Psychology and Linguistics & English Language (LEL)
Scholarship Award: The Award provides full-time tuition fees (UK/EU or overseas level) with an annual stipend of £14,553 for three years (pro rata for part-time students)
Nationality: The Scholarship is available to international students.
a number of scholarship: Number not given.
Scholarship can be taken in the UK

Eligibility for the Scholarship:

  • Eligible Countries: International students. are eligible to apply for this scholarship
  • Entrance Requirement: The successful applicant will have a very good undergraduate degree in a relevant discipline and ideally will have, or will be studying for, a postgraduate master’s degree (or equivalent).
    • Existing doctoral researchers (i.e. those in their 1st or 2nd year of doctoral study) are not eligible for this award.
    • These scholarships are funded by the School of PPLS.
